See more Fix Workshop
Fits 1997-2006 bmw e46 323i 328i windshield cowl grille cover Bmw windshield cowl replacement Cowl e46 bmw windshield genuine series ecs 2005
Windshield cowl cover, genuine bmw Oem bmw e46 3 series windshield cowl cover Fits 1997-2006 bmw e46 323i 328i windshield cowl grille cover
Compare price: bmw 328i windshield cowlCowl cover refresh kit bmw windshield genuine Windshield cowl cover with mounting clips, bmwFits 1997-2006 bmw e46 323i 328i windshield cowl grille cover.
Windshield cowl cover, genuine bmwRevealed: the best bmw e46 windshield cowl to upgrade your car! Cowl windshield cover bmwWindshield cowl cover, genuine bmw.
Windshield cowl cover with mounting clips, bmwOem bmw e46 3 series windshield cowl cover 2013 bmw 328i windshield cowlOem bmw e46 3 series windshield cowl cover.
Oem bmw e46 3 series windshield cowl coverHow to change wiper motor 2012-2016 bmw 328i sedan windshield cowl assy 51-71-7-258-177E83 windshield cowl.
Bmw cowl windshield 328i trimRevealed: the best bmw e46 windshield cowl to upgrade your car! 2013-2015 bmw x1 e84 suv front windshield cowl cover panel trim set ofEcs news.
Loose windshield cowl / leaking into 2012 328xi footwellWindshield cover cowl bmw wagon e46 sedan door Bmw 5 series windshield replacement costWindshield cowl cover genuine bmw g42 g22 g23 g26 g80 g82 g83.
Oem bmw e46 3 series windshield cowl cover2013-2015 bmw x1 e84 suv front windshield cowl cover panel trim set of Bmw 328xi 2007 sedan front left side lower windshield cowl panel.
.
Revealed: The Best BMW E46 Windshield Cowl to Upgrade Your Car!
2013 Bmw 328i Windshield Cowl
Compare Price: bmw 328i windshield cowl - on StatementsLtd.com
2013-2015 BMW 328I F30 SEDAN FRONT WINDSHIELD COWL PANEL SEAL STRIP SET
BMW 328XI 2007 SEDAN FRONT LEFT SIDE LOWER WINDSHIELD COWL PANEL
Windshield Cowl Cover with Mounting Clips, BMW - E46 4-Door (1999-2005)
Fits 1997-2006 BMW E46 323i 328i Windshield Cowl Grille Cover | eBay
OEM BMW E46 3 Series Windshield Cowl Cover | Pricepulse